D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Y
Federal Energy Regulatory Commission
[Docket No. EC05-110-000]
MidAmerican Energy Holdings Company; Scottish Power plc;
PacifiCorp Holdings, Inc.; PacifiCorp; Notice of Filing
July 26, 2005.
Take notice that on July 22, 2005, MidAmerican Energy Holdings
Company (MEHC), Scottish Power plc, PacifiCorp and PacifiCorp Holdings,
Inc., (PacifiCorp Holdings) filed with the Federal Energy Regulatory
Commission an application pursuant to section 203 of the Federal Power
Act for authorization of the sale of PacifiCorp from PacifiCorp
Holdings to a wholly owned, indirect subsidiary of MEHC.
The applicants also are requesting confidential treatment pursuant
to 18 CFR 388.112 for certain data submitted in support of the
application.
